Delivering Effective Appraisals
This course provides managers, team leaders, and supervisors with the knowledge and tools to deliver effective staff supervision and appraisals. Delegates will explore the purpose and structure of appraisals, how to give constructive feedback, and how to overcome common barriers. The session also introduces key communication techniques, conflict resolution strategies, and the Situational Leadership Model. Ideal for those with line management or with supervisory responsibilities in all sectors.
